Non-invaded formation density measurement and photoelectric evaluation using an x-ray source

1. An x-ray based litho-density tool comprising:
an output exit;
an x-ray source that is offset from the output exit in an axial direction, the x-ray source to generate radiant energy that illuminates a formation surrounding a borehole via the output exit;
a source monitoring detector that is offset from the output exit in the axial direction and positioned between the x-ray source and the output exit; and
a radiation detector to generate data indicative of a density of the formation using the radiant energy, the radiation detector offset from the output exit in the axial direction and positioned between the x-ray source and the source monitoring detector.
